About Bob Muglia


B ob Muglia is a veteran technology executive who became a billionaire as the former CEO of the cloud data company, Snowflake. With a long and distinguished career in the software industry, Muglia is best known for his 23-year tenure at Microsoft, where he rose to become a senior executive leading major divisions, including the server and tools business, which was a multi-billion dollar enterprise.

After leaving Microsoft, he held executive roles at Juniper Networks before being appointed CEO of the then-startup Snowflake in 2014. Muglia was instrumental in taking Snowflake out of stealth mode and building it into a major force in the cloud data warehousing market. He led the company through its early, critical growth phase, securing major customers and funding. Although he was replaced as CEO by Frank Slootman in 2019, before the company's historic IPO, Muglia's leadership was foundational to its success, and his stake in the company made him a billionaire.

Career Journey of Bob Muglia


Bob Muglia was a high-ranking executive at Microsoft for 23 years, where he was instrumental in developing and managing key products, including the company's enterprise application and server divisions. His transition from Microsoft, the old guard of software, to the new world of cloud-native systems proved definitive. The pivotal moment came in June 2014 when Muglia was named CEO of Snowflake Inc., then a relatively unknown cloud data storage startup.

Muglia's leadership at Snowflake was crucial in guiding the company out of 'stealth mode' and into its initial phase of hyper-growth. He leveraged his extensive network and enterprise credibility to secure major partnerships and funding. Under his tenure, Snowflake expanded its operations, establishing its unique cloud data platform that operated across major providers like Amazon Web Services and Microsoft Azure. His efforts laid the groundwork for Snowflake's eventual historic IPO, cementing his legacy as a leader who successfully transitioned a promising startup into a market-defining entity.

Bob Muglia's Timeline


1980s–2010s:

Serves as a high-ranking executive at Microsoft Corporation (Foundational Career).

2014 (June):

Named CEO of Snowflake Inc. (Executive Transition).

2014 (October):

Snowflake comes out of stealth mode with 80 initial organizations using the platform (Market Launch).

2015 (June):

Snowflake launches its first product, its cloud data warehouse (Product Milestone).

2019 (May):

Steps down as CEO of Snowflake (Executive Departure).

2020 (September):

Snowflake executes a successful IPO (Financial Milestone).

Ongoing:

Continues to serve as an advisor in the data and cloud technology sector (Current Focus).
